Output e8a3e71baba0485c6b35ed981b160e7221aa0ad42c9219bb0cb0ea9240b77c95:0

value
354333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f159c39dcaeaec2e4a3025c46a23d3a2be72c0c6 OP_EQUAL
address
3PhAJhJhWVVparK9Vc6fBwx621kk8d1cLT
transaction
e8a3e71baba0485c6b35ed981b160e7221aa0ad42c9219bb0cb0ea9240b77c95
spent
true